Based on the latest financial reports, GMR Power and Urban Infra Limited (GMRP&UI) has total liabilities worth Rs150.30 Billion INR (≈ $1.63 Billion USD) as of September 2025. Total liabilities represent everything the company owes to external parties, combining both current liabilities—like accounts payable, short-term debt, and accrued expenses—and non-current liabilities such as long-term debt, pension obligations, lease liabilities, and deferred tax liabilities. Liquidity & Leverage Metrics

Key Metrics Explained

Metric Value Description
Current Ratio 1.50 Measures ability to pay short-term obligations (Current Assets ÷ Current Liabilities)
Quick Ratio N/A More stringent measure of short-term liquidity ((Current Assets - Inventory) ÷ Current Liabilities)
Cash Ratio N/A Most conservative liquidity measure (Cash & Equivalents ÷ Current Liabilities)
Debt to Equity 10.67 Measures financial leverage (Total Liabilities ÷ Shareholder Equity)
Debt to Assets 0.90 Portion of assets financed with debt (Total Liabilities ÷ Total Assets)

GMR Power And Urban Infra Limited engages in the energy, urban infrastructure, and transportation businesses in India. It operates through Power, Smart Meter Infrastructure, Roads, EPC, and Others segments. The company generates energy through coal based thermal plants, hydropower plants, and solar and wind, as well as offers installation of smart meters.
